CVE-2026-0791
CVE-2026-0791
CVSS Vector
v3.1- Attack Vector
- Network
- Attack Complexity
- Low
- Privileges Required
- None
- User Interaction
- None
- Scope
- Unchanged
- Confidentiality
- High
- Integrity
- High
- Availability
- High
Description
ALGO 8180 IP Audio Alerter SIP INVITE Replaces Stack-based Buffer Overflow Remote Code Execution Vulnerability. This vulnerability allows remote attackers to execute arbitrary code on affected installations of ALGO 8180 IP Audio Alerter devices. Authentication is not required to exploit this vulnerability. The specific flaw exists within the handling of the Replaces header of SIP INVITE requests. The issue results from the lack of proper validation of the length of user-supplied data prior to copying it to a fixed-length stack-based buffer. An attacker can leverage this vulnerability to execute code in the context of the device. Was ZDI-CAN-28300.
Comprehensive Technical Analysis of CVE-2026-0791
1. Vulnerability Assessment and Severity Evaluation
CVE ID: CVE-2026-0791 CVSS Score: 9.8
The vulnerability in question, CVE-2026-0791, is a critical stack-based buffer overflow in the ALGO 8180 IP Audio Alerter device. This vulnerability arises from improper validation of the length of user-supplied data in the Replaces header of SIP INVITE requests. The lack of proper validation allows an attacker to overwrite adjacent memory, potentially leading to remote code execution (RCE).
Severity Evaluation:
- CVSS Score: 9.8 (Critical)
- Impact: High
- Exploitability: High
The high CVSS score indicates that this vulnerability poses a significant risk. The ability to execute arbitrary code without authentication makes it particularly dangerous.
2. Potential Attack Vectors and Exploitation Methods
Attack Vectors:
- Network-Based Attack: An attacker can send specially crafted SIP INVITE requests to the vulnerable device over the network.
- Man-in-the-Middle (MitM): An attacker could intercept and modify SIP INVITE requests to include malicious payloads.
Exploitation Methods:
- Buffer Overflow: By sending a SIP INVITE request with an overly long Replaces header, an attacker can overflow the stack-based buffer.
- Code Execution: The buffer overflow can be leveraged to inject and execute arbitrary code, potentially leading to full control over the device.
3. Affected Systems and Software Versions
Affected Systems:
- ALGO 8180 IP Audio Alerter devices
Software Versions:
- Specific versions affected are not mentioned in the provided information. It is crucial to identify and patch all versions of the firmware that are vulnerable to this issue.
4. Recommended Mitigation Strategies
Immediate Actions:
- Patch Management: Apply the latest firmware updates provided by the vendor as soon as they are available.
- Network Segmentation: Isolate the ALGO 8180 IP Audio Alerter devices from the broader network to limit exposure.
- Firewall Rules: Implement strict firewall rules to restrict access to the device, allowing only trusted sources to communicate with it.
Long-Term Strategies:
- Regular Audits: Conduct regular security audits and vulnerability assessments.
- Intrusion Detection Systems (IDS): Deploy IDS to monitor for suspicious SIP traffic patterns.
- User Training: Educate users on the importance of reporting any unusual device behavior.
5. Impact on Cybersecurity Landscape
Broader Implications:
- IoT Security: This vulnerability highlights the ongoing challenges in securing Internet of Things (IoT) devices, which are often deployed in critical infrastructure.
- Supply Chain Risks: Vulnerabilities in third-party devices can introduce significant risks into an organization's security posture.
- Compliance: Organizations must ensure compliance with security standards and regulations, especially in sectors like healthcare and finance, where such devices might be used.
6. Technical Details for Security Professionals
Vulnerability Details:
- Root Cause: The vulnerability stems from a lack of proper input validation in the handling of the Replaces header in SIP INVITE requests.
- Exploitation: An attacker can craft a SIP INVITE request with a maliciously long Replaces header, causing a buffer overflow. This overflow can be used to inject and execute arbitrary code.
- Mitigation: Ensure that all input data is properly validated and sanitized before processing. Implement bounds checking to prevent buffer overflows.
Detection and Response:
- Log Analysis: Monitor logs for unusual SIP traffic patterns, especially those involving the Replaces header.
- Anomaly Detection: Use anomaly detection tools to identify deviations from normal SIP traffic behavior.
- Incident Response: Have an incident response plan in place to quickly address any detected exploitation attempts.
Conclusion: CVE-2026-0791 is a critical vulnerability that underscores the importance of robust input validation and secure coding practices. Organizations using the ALGO 8180 IP Audio Alerter devices should prioritize patching and implement comprehensive security measures to mitigate the risk. Regular audits and continuous monitoring are essential to maintain a strong security posture in the face of such threats.